Setting Up GeForce NOW on Your Xbox

To connect GeForce NOW to your Xbox, you will need to follow a series of clear steps. While GeForce NOW is not natively supported on Xbox, you can access it through the Microsoft Edge browser available on Xbox consoles. Below are the steps to get started:

Step 1: Prepare Your Xbox

  1. Update Your Xbox Console: Ensure that your Xbox is running the latest system software. You can check for updates by going to Settings > System > Updates. An updated console will provide a better browsing experience and ensure compatibility.

  2. Connect to the Internet: Make sure your Xbox is connected to a stable internet connection. A wired connection is preferable for optimal performance. You can check your connection by going to Settings > Network > Network settings.

Step 2: Accessing Microsoft Edge on Xbox

  1. Launch Microsoft Edge: From your Xbox dashboard, scroll to the Apps section and open Microsoft Edge. If you don’t have it installed, you can find it in the Microsoft Store.

  2. Navigate to the GeForce NOW Website: In the Edge browser, type in the URL for GeForce NOW: https://www.nvidia.com/en-us/geforce-now/ and hit enter.

Step 3: Log in to your GeForce NOW Account

  1. Sign In: If you already have a GeForce NOW account, enter your credentials to log in. If not, you’ll need to create a new account.

  2. Subscription Plan: GeForce NOW offers various subscription plans, including a free tier. Depending on your gaming needs, choose a plan that best suits you. The priority and RTX 3080 memberships provide enhanced performance and access to games with ray tracing capabilities.

Step 4: Optimize Your Streaming Settings

  • Adjust Streaming Quality: Under your account settings, you can optimize the streaming quality according to your internet speed and visual preferences. Choosing the right resolution and framerate can significantly impact your gaming experience.

  • Test Internet Speed: Before diving into gameplay, you might want to conduct a speed test to ensure your connection is suitable for gaming. A minimum of 15 Mbps is recommended for 720p resolution at 60 FPS, while 25 Mbps or higher is preferred for 1080p.

Step 5: Start Playing Your Games

  1. Select Your Favorite Games: Once you are logged in, navigate to your library and select any game you wish to play. GeForce NOW supports a wide range of games from platforms like Steam, Epic Games Store, and Uplay.

  2. Launch and Play: After selecting a game, click on the play button. You may need to wait a few moments for the game to load on the Nvidia servers.

Do I need a powerful internet connection to use GeForce NOW on Xbox?

Yes, a stable and fast internet connection is crucial for the best experience with GeForce NOW on Xbox. NVIDIA recommends a minimum download speed of 15 Mbps for 720p streaming and at least 25 Mbps for 1080p streaming. A wired connection is preferable as it typically offers more stability compared to Wi-Fi. However, if using Wi-Fi, ensure you’re on a reliable network to minimize lag and ensure smoother gameplay.

Additionally, factors such as network congestion and distance from the GeForce NOW servers can affect performance. To enhance your gaming experience, try to minimize background internet activity (like streaming or downloads) while gaming. Furthermore, using quality-of-service (QoS) settings on your router can prioritize gaming traffic, helping to maintain a stable connection during intense gaming sessions.

Is there a subscription fee for GeForce NOW on Xbox?

GeForce NOW offers a tiered subscription model, including a free option and paid tiers. The free tier allows players to access the service with some limitations such as session lengths and potential queue times during peak hours. For users looking for enhanced features like longer session durations, priority access during busy times, and the ability to play in higher resolutions, paid subscriptions such as the Priority and RTX 3080 tiers are available for a monthly fee.

The pricing structure and available features may vary, so it’s advisable to check the official GeForce NOW website for the latest information. Additionally, NVIDIA frequently updates their service and may offer special promotions, allowing users to experience premium features at a discounted rate or for free during trial periods.
